Once installed you will notice a new menu called ‘MrExcelHTML’. This appears in the worksheet menu bar for Excel versions 2003 and earlier, or within the ‘Add-Ins’ tab in Excel 2007 and more recent versions.
Here is my experience with Jeanie and Excel 2013: it will install, but not at the “official” add-in folder. Move the .xla file there. To know where to copy it, go to Developer/Add-Ins/Search, the dialog box will show the path. In my case it is:
C:\Users\Eddie\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\AddIns
When you close and reopen Excel, the Add-in tab will be gone.
To make it reappear, go to that dialog box, select the .xla file and click Open. It is boring to do this all the time, maybe we should email the Jeanie guy at his site.
